INTERACTIVE PROJECTION SYSTEM AND OPERATION METHOD THEREOF
20230308618 · 2023-09-28 · ·

An interactive projection system including a projector and a touch interactive light source device is provided. The projector includes a projection optical engine, a camera module, and a control module. The touch interactive light source device includes at least one infrared light source module and a wireless signal transmission module. The control module is electrically connected to the projection optical engine and the camera module, and controls the touch interactive light source device through the wireless signal transmission module, so that the touch interactive light source device is placed in a recommended installation position and the interactive projection system is in an interactive mode. An operation method of the interactive projection system is also provided.

INFORMATION PROCESSING APPARATUS, NON-TRANSITORY COMPUTER READABLE MEDIUM STORING INFORMATION PROCESSING PROGRAM, AND INFORMATION PROCESSING METHOD
20230305662 · 2023-09-28 · ·

An information processing apparatus includes a processor configured to: detect a closest portion being a portion having a shortest distance from an operation surface in a perpendicular direction of the operation surface among portions of an object in a spatial region facing the operation surface; determine a position on the operation surface corresponding to a position of the closest portion as an instruction input position by a non-contact operation of a user; and, in a case where a distance between a first position of the closest portion, which is detected at a first time point, and a second position of the closest portion, which is detected at a second time point after a minute time has elapsed from the first time point, in a plane direction parallel to the operation surface is equal to or longer than a threshold distance, invalidate an instruction input on a position on the operation surface corresponding to the second position or output a warning to the user.

Character input apparatus and method for automatically switching input mode in terminal having touch screen

Provided is a character input method and apparatus for automatically switching an input mode in a terminal having a touch screen. If a press event occurs in one of key regions displayed in the touch screen, it is determined whether a drag event occurs prior to occurrence of a release event. According to whether the drag event occurs, one of a separate input mode for inputting one of characters of a corresponding character group and a text input mode for inputting a word including one of the characters of the character group is executed. Thus, a user can easily input a character by rapidly selecting a desired input mode.

TOUCH DISPLAY DEVICE
20230297189 · 2023-09-21 · ·

A touch display device includes several LED units and several switches. Each LED unit includes a LED and a photo sensor. The switches are electrically coupled to the LED units. During a conductive period of a conductive one of the switches, the LEDs and the photo sensor coupled to the conductive one are enabled non-simultaneously.

Image display apparatus and method for controlling the same
11188170 · 2021-11-30 · ·

An image display apparatus includes a display section that displays an image on a display surface, an output section that outputs light, a changer that changes the angle of the light outputted from the output section with respect to the display surface, a position detector that detects a reflected position where the light outputted by the output section is reflected, and a change controller that controls the changer based on the result of the detection performed by the position detector.

Display Device

A display device capable of reducing a non-display area includes a substrate hole surrounded by light emitting elements, and a moisture penetration preventing layer disposed between an inner dam surrounded by the light emitting elements and the substrate hole. Accordingly, it is possible to prevent damage to light emitting stacks caused by external moisture or oxygen. Since the substrate hole is disposed within an active area, a reduction in non-display area is achieved.
